发布web项目配置tomcate服务器_发布项目
创始人
2024-12-08 00:37:25
0
摘要:本文介绍了如何在Tomcat服务器上发布Web项目。内容包括项目配置、部署步骤以及确保Tomcat正确运行所需的设置。指导读者完成从项目准备到最终发布的全过程,使Web应用顺利在Tomcat服务器上运行。

在发布Web项目到Tomcat服务器这一过程中,涉及到多个关键步骤,包括配置Tomcat服务器、部署Web项目、以及设置访问路径等,下面将深入探讨这些步骤,并给出详细的操作指南:

发布web项目配置tomcate服务器_发布项目(图片来源网络,侵删)

1、准备工作

创建Web项目:启动IntelliJ IDEA,通过选择File > New > Project来新建一个项目,在弹出的窗口中,选择项目类型,并填写项目名称及其他相关配置信息,创建项目后,需要对项目结构进行配置和设置。

添加Web框架支持:确保你的项目已经被选择,在顶部菜单中选择File > Project Structure > Modules,点击加号,选择Web,然后选择Web Application (4.0)点击OK,这一步是为了确保项目支持Web应用的基础设置。

2、配置Tomcat服务器

设置服务器基本信息:在IntelliJ IDEA中,选择RunEdit Configurations,点击右上角的+号,然后在弹出的选项中找到Tomcat Server,选择Local Server,设置Tomcat服务器的显示名,并选择Configure。

选择Tomcat安装位置:在弹出的配置窗口中,选择Tomcat在磁盘中的安装位置,确认之后,系统会自动识别出Tomcat服务器以及访问路径和端口。

3、部署Web项目

发布web项目配置tomcate服务器_发布项目(图片来源网络,侵删)

选择部署项目:在配置好Tomcat服务器之后,下一步是选择部署选项,点击右边的+,弹出的项目中选择Artfact,在弹出的项目中,选择带有"war exploded"的那一个项目,然后进行确认。

设置访问路径:最后一步是设置访问路径,如果只输入斜杠(/),则表示不需要通过项目名来访问。

通过上述步骤,可以将一个Web项目成功发布到Tomcat服务器上,将补充一些可能需要用到的高级知识和注意事项:

配置虚拟目录:在某些情况下,可能需要配置Tomcat的虚拟目录,这可以通过修改Tomcat的配置文件来实现,具体方法可以参考相关文档。

远程服务器部署:如果是将项目部署到远程的Tomcat服务器上,还需要设置远程服务器的访问路径,这通常涉及到网络配置和服务器操作系统的相关知识。

归纳而言,通过上述步骤和注意事项的指导,应该能够顺利完成Web项目到Tomcat服务器的发布过程,在实际的操作过程中,可能会遇到各种问题,关键在于不断实践和积累经验,同时充分利用网络资源和社区的帮助。


发布web项目配置tomcate服务器_发布项目(图片来源网络,侵删)

下面是一个简化版的介绍,描述了在常见开发环境中发布Web项目并配置Tomcat服务器的步骤:

步骤 IntelliJ IDEA Eclipse Visual Studio Code 服务器上直接部署
创建Web项目 选择Web Application模板创建项目 创建Dynamic Web Project 使用相应模板或手动创建Web项目结构
配置Web模块 设置Web模块的根目录和Web资源目录 在项目属性中设置
打包项目 创建Web Application: Exploded类型的Artifact 导出WAR文件 使用mvn package命令(如果使用Maven) 将编译好的项目目录或WAR包准备好
配置Tomcat服务器 在Run/Debug Configurations中添加Tomcat Server 在Preferences中添加Tomcat Server 通过扩展包和launch.json配置 下载和安装Tomcat,配置环境变量
设置部署 在Tomcat配置中添加Artifact 将WAR文件放置到Tomcat的webapps目录 配置Tomcat启动参数 将项目目录或WAR包放置到Tomcat的webapps目录
启动Tomcat 点击IDEA中的启动按钮 启动Eclipse中的Tomcat服务器 在VS Code中启动Tomcat 双击startup.bat或执行bin/startup.sh
访问Web项目 使用配置的URL访问 浏览器中输入URL访问 使用配置的端口和路径访问 在浏览器中输入服务器的IP和端口访问
更新部署 重新部署Artifact 删除旧的WAR包,放置新的WAR包 重新启动Tomcat 停止Tomcat,替换webapps目录下的项目,重新启动Tomcat

请注意,介绍中的步骤可能需要根据具体的项目需求和使用的工具/版本进行调整,在服务器上直接部署时,通常需要手动管理Tomcat的生命周期和项目的部署更新,而在集成开发环境(IDE)中,很多步骤可以通过图形界面简化操作。

相关内容

热门资讯

一分钟内幕!科乐吉林麻将系统发... 一分钟内幕!科乐吉林麻将系统发牌规律,福建大玩家确实真的是有挂,技巧教程(有挂ai代打);所有人都在...
一分钟揭秘!微扑克辅助软件(透... 一分钟揭秘!微扑克辅助软件(透视辅助)确实是有挂(2024已更新)(哔哩哔哩);1、用户打开应用后不...
五分钟发现!广东雀神麻雀怎么赢... 五分钟发现!广东雀神麻雀怎么赢,朋朋棋牌都是是真的有挂,高科技教程(有挂方法)1、广东雀神麻雀怎么赢...
每日必看!人皇大厅吗(透明挂)... 每日必看!人皇大厅吗(透明挂)好像存在有挂(2026已更新)(哔哩哔哩);人皇大厅吗辅助器中分为三种...
重大科普!新华棋牌有挂吗(透视... 重大科普!新华棋牌有挂吗(透视)一直是有挂(2021已更新)(哔哩哔哩)1、完成新华棋牌有挂吗的残局...
二分钟内幕!微信小程序途游辅助... 二分钟内幕!微信小程序途游辅助器,掌中乐游戏中心其实存在有挂,微扑克教程(有挂规律)二分钟内幕!微信...
科技揭秘!jj斗地主系统控牌吗... 科技揭秘!jj斗地主系统控牌吗(透视)本来真的是有挂(2025已更新)(哔哩哔哩)1、科技揭秘!jj...
1分钟普及!哈灵麻将攻略小,微... 1分钟普及!哈灵麻将攻略小,微信小程序十三张好像存在有挂,规律教程(有挂技巧)哈灵麻将攻略小是一种具...
9分钟教程!科乐麻将有挂吗,传... 9分钟教程!科乐麻将有挂吗,传送屋高防版辅助(总是存在有挂)1、完成传送屋高防版辅助透视辅助安装,帮...
每日必看教程!兴动游戏辅助器下... 每日必看教程!兴动游戏辅助器下载(辅助)真是真的有挂(2025已更新)(哔哩哔哩)1、打开软件启动之...